How Worried Should Investors Be About a Jerome Powell Investigation?

(Image credit: Getty Images)

The Department of Justice served the Federal Reserve with grand jury subpoenas on Friday and threatened a criminal indictment related to Fed Chair Jerome Powell’s testimony before the Senate Banking Committee last June about a multi-year project to renovate historic buildings.

That’s according to a Sunday evening statement from Powell, whose term as Fed chair expires in May.
